Chirinos winner sees off struggling Chivas

Michaell Chirinos scored in the second half as Lobos BUAP beat Chivas Guadalajara 1-0 at the Estadio Akron to add further misery to the Rojiblancos.

The defeat means Chivas are five points away from eighth place Puebla with only four games left to play in the regular season.

Chivas, who arrived to this match on the back of two straight Liga MX defeats, started on the front foot. Alexis Vega created the first big opportunity of the game when he sent a shot just inches wide of the Puebla goal.

Vega would eventually put his name on the stat sheet but not for a good reason.
